4,294,990,004 is a composite number, even.
4,294,990,004 (four billion two hundred ninety-four million nine hundred ninety thousand four) is an even 10-digit number. It is a composite number with 12 divisors, and factors as 2² × 137 × 7,837,573. Written other ways, in hexadecimal, 0x1000058B4.
